Output 51bd458686cccde199e59c2e1f54199c23aa57d82898ed7ea028e4af7cb9a121:2

value
58291
script pubkey
OP_0 OP_PUSHBYTES_20 ebd31362a94e720ba2dce02ce783cd3a28029594
address
bc1qa0f3xc4ffeeqhgkuuqkw0q7d8g5q99v5lljcyj
transaction
51bd458686cccde199e59c2e1f54199c23aa57d82898ed7ea028e4af7cb9a121
spent
true